6166|1

5

帖子

0

TA的资源

一粒金砂(初级)

楼主
 

DSP处理器的选型问题 [复制链接]

    目前市场上的主要DSP生产商包括TIADIMotorolaLucentZilog等,其中TI占有最大市场份额。产品包括了从低端的低速度DSP到高端的大运算量的DSP产品。目前,广泛使用的TI DSP有三个系列:C2000C5000C6000(C3X也有使用),其它型号都基本淘汰。需要提醒注意的是:在TIDSP中,同一系列中不同型号的DSP都具有相同的DSP核,相同或兼容的汇编指令系统,其差别仅在于片内存储器的大小,外设资源(如定时器、串口、并口等)的多少;不同系列DSP的汇编指令系统不兼容,但汇编语言的语法非常相似。除了汇编语言外,TI还为每个系列都提供了优化的C/C++编译器,方便用户使用高级语言进行开发,效率可以达到手工汇编的90%甚至更高。

在具体的开发中,根据所设计的系统要求和最终产品的成本估算,一般从以下几个方面去考虑选择什么型号的DSP处理器:

1.dsp是嵌入式技术的一个部分,我们应该清楚dsp是运算型的芯片,在整个系统中它是专门完成算法的运算单元,基本不做其他处理。

2.我们要搞清楚前端模拟信号的特点,普通的音频还是超声波,图片还是连续的图像,一路还是多路,是间断波形还是连续的波形。

3.算法的复杂度,要求的数据精度。通过23点,我们就确定下来前端a/d的选型。

4.确定应用环境,要求实时或者不要求实时,比如指纹识别0.1秒和3秒的差别就不大,如果雷达信号处理0.1秒和0.2秒处理完毕的效果就差很远。这样我们就可以确定处理器的运算速率。

5.民品,性能价格比敏感型。工业品,功能敏感型。军品可靠性敏感型。

6.系统设计简易原则,无论军品民品可靠性都是非常重要的,系统越复杂可靠性越差,所以在设计硬件前应该尽量多考虑系统的简洁性,选用集成度高的芯片是非常好的办法。

比如ti公司的5402,价格5美金,运算能力强100mips但是外围需要很多外设,比如ram,flash都要外扩,在这样情况下无形中系统就复杂了, 所以目前很多用户开始使用高集成度的ARM处理器芯片,Atmel有一款芯片70mips32位处理器,片内带2M巨大flash,能加密,片内ram大的很,扩展口一大堆,io32根;316位定时器;2个串口,可以支持跑操作系统,价格8.5美金。选用这款芯片不但电路可以大大简化,而且价格便宜的要命。硬件成功率也大幅提高。

如果是高速图形处理,那么必须选用6000系列再加上事务单元和ram,后来ti为了提高性能推出6203片内有7MRAM,有些情况下就不用扩RAM了。这也是为了尽量简化系统而推出的。

7.适宜原则,不要杀鸡使牛刀,比如一个音频系统你非要用TMS320C6701那么不但成本升高而且开发成功率也大打折扣。

8.优先供货原则,不要用太旧的片子,各大IC厂家每年都有部分片子停产,并且即将停产的片子贵很多,所以尽量用新类型的片子,不但技术先进而且由于摩尔定律的原因价格也非常便宜。

 

最新回复

楼主辛苦了,帮你顶上去  详情 回复 发表于 2008-1-25 08:20
点赞 关注
 

回复
举报

71

帖子

0

TA的资源

五彩晶圆(中级)

沙发
 

回复:DSP处理器的选型问题

楼主辛苦了,帮你顶上去
个人签名http://www.CINZY.com-CINZY\'LAB辛仔实验室
 
 

回复
您需要登录后才可以回帖 登录 | 注册

查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/8 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2025 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表